jqh 5 лет назад
Родитель
Сommit
fbea1dc50a

+ 4 - 4
resources/views/layouts/content.blade.php

@@ -24,7 +24,7 @@
 @endsection
 
 @section('app')
-    {!! Dcat\Admin\Admin::assets()->renderStyle() !!}
+    {!! Dcat\Admin\Admin::asset()->renderStyle() !!}
 
     <div class="content-header">
         @yield('content-header')
@@ -40,7 +40,7 @@
         {!! admin_section(AdminSection::APP_INNER_AFTER) !!}
     </div>
 
-    {!! Dcat\Admin\Admin::assets()->renderScript() !!}
+    {!! Dcat\Admin\Admin::asset()->renderScript() !!}
     {!! Dcat\Admin\Admin::html() !!}
 @endsection
 
@@ -51,8 +51,8 @@
 
     <script>Dcat.pjaxResponded()</script>
 
-    {!! Dcat\Admin\Admin::assets()->renderCss() !!}
-    {!! Dcat\Admin\Admin::assets()->renderJs() !!}
+    {!! Dcat\Admin\Admin::asset()->renderCss() !!}
+    {!! Dcat\Admin\Admin::asset()->renderJs() !!}
 
     @yield('app')
 @endif

+ 4 - 4
resources/views/layouts/form-content.blade.php

@@ -12,14 +12,14 @@
     <section class="form-content">{!! $content !!}</section>
 @endsection
 
-{!! Dcat\Admin\Admin::assets()->renderCss() !!}
-{!! Dcat\Admin\Admin::assets()->renderJs() !!}
+{!! Dcat\Admin\Admin::asset()->renderCss() !!}
+{!! Dcat\Admin\Admin::asset()->renderJs() !!}
 
-{!! Dcat\Admin\Admin::assets()->renderStyle() !!}
+{!! Dcat\Admin\Admin::asset()->renderStyle() !!}
 
 @yield('content')
 
-{!! Dcat\Admin\Admin::assets()->renderScript() !!}
+{!! Dcat\Admin\Admin::asset()->renderScript() !!}
 {!! Dcat\Admin\Admin::html() !!}
 
 {{--select2下拉选框z-index必须大于弹窗的值--}}

+ 4 - 4
resources/views/layouts/full-content.blade.php

@@ -10,7 +10,7 @@
 @endsection
 
 @section('app')
-    {!! Dcat\Admin\Admin::assets()->renderStyle() !!}
+    {!! Dcat\Admin\Admin::asset()->renderStyle() !!}
 
     <div class="content-body" id="app">
         {{-- 页面埋点--}}
@@ -22,7 +22,7 @@
         {!! admin_section(AdminSection::APP_INNER_AFTER) !!}
     </div>
 
-    {!! Dcat\Admin\Admin::assets()->renderScript() !!}
+    {!! Dcat\Admin\Admin::asset()->renderScript() !!}
     {!! Dcat\Admin\Admin::html() !!}
 @endsection
 
@@ -34,8 +34,8 @@
 
     <script>Dcat.pjaxResponded();</script>
 
-    {!! Dcat\Admin\Admin::assets()->renderCss() !!}
-    {!! Dcat\Admin\Admin::assets()->renderJs() !!}
+    {!! Dcat\Admin\Admin::asset()->renderCss() !!}
+    {!! Dcat\Admin\Admin::asset()->renderJs() !!}
 
     @yield('app')
 @endif

+ 3 - 3
resources/views/layouts/full-page.blade.php

@@ -20,9 +20,9 @@
 
     {!! admin_section(\AdminSection::HEAD) !!}
 
-    {!! Dcat\Admin\Admin::assets()->renderCss() !!}
+    {!! Dcat\Admin\Admin::asset()->renderCss() !!}
 
-    {!! Dcat\Admin\Admin::assets()->renderHeaderJs() !!}
+    {!! Dcat\Admin\Admin::asset()->renderHeaderJs() !!}
 
     @yield('head')
 </head>
@@ -46,7 +46,7 @@
 
 {!! admin_section(\AdminSection::BODY_INNER_AFTER) !!}
 
-{!! Dcat\Admin\Admin::assets()->renderJs() !!}
+{!! Dcat\Admin\Admin::asset()->renderJs() !!}
 
 </body>
 </html>

+ 2 - 2
resources/views/layouts/page.blade.php

@@ -20,9 +20,9 @@
 
     {!! admin_section(\AdminSection::HEAD) !!}
 
-    {!! Dcat\Admin\Admin::assets()->renderCss() !!}
+    {!! Dcat\Admin\Admin::asset()->renderCss() !!}
 
-    {!! Dcat\Admin\Admin::assets()->renderHeaderJs() !!}
+    {!! Dcat\Admin\Admin::asset()->renderHeaderJs() !!}
 
     <!--[if lt IE 9]>
     <script src="https://oss.maxcdn.com/html5shiv/3.7.3/html5shiv.min.js"></script>

+ 1 - 1
resources/views/layouts/vertical.blade.php

@@ -70,7 +70,7 @@
     {!! admin_section(\AdminSection::BODY_INNER_AFTER) !!}
 
         <!-- REQUIRED JS SCRIPTS -->
-    {!! Dcat\Admin\Admin::assets()->renderJs() !!}
+    {!! Dcat\Admin\Admin::asset()->renderJs() !!}
 
 </body>
 

+ 3 - 3
src/AdminServiceProvider.php

@@ -2,7 +2,7 @@
 
 namespace Dcat\Admin;
 
-use Dcat\Admin\Layout\Assets;
+use Dcat\Admin\Layout\Asset;
 use Dcat\Admin\Layout\Content;
 use Dcat\Admin\Layout\Menu;
 use Dcat\Admin\Layout\Navbar;
@@ -146,7 +146,7 @@ class AdminServiceProvider extends ServiceProvider
             $this->publishes([__DIR__.'/../config' => config_path()], 'dcat-admin-config');
             $this->publishes([__DIR__.'/../resources/lang' => resource_path('lang')], 'dcat-admin-lang');
             $this->publishes([__DIR__.'/../database/migrations' => database_path('migrations')], 'dcat-admin-migrations');
-            $this->publishes([__DIR__.'/../resources/assets/dist' => public_path(Admin::assets()->getRealPath('@admin'))], 'dcat-admin-assets');
+            $this->publishes([__DIR__.'/../resources/assets/dist' => public_path(Admin::asset()->getRealPath('@admin'))], 'dcat-admin-assets');
         }
     }
 
@@ -197,7 +197,7 @@ class AdminServiceProvider extends ServiceProvider
 
     protected function registerServices()
     {
-        $this->app->singleton('admin.assets', Assets::class);
+        $this->app->singleton('admin.asset', Asset::class);
         $this->app->singleton('admin.color', Color::class);
         $this->app->singleton('admin.sections', SectionManager::class);
         $this->app->singleton('admin.navbar', Navbar::class);

+ 2 - 2
src/Console/Development/LinkCommand.php

@@ -31,7 +31,7 @@ class LinkCommand extends Command
 
     protected function linkAssets()
     {
-        $basePath = Admin::assets()->getRealPath('@admin');
+        $basePath = Admin::asset()->getRealPath('@admin');
         $publicPath = public_path($basePath);
 
         if (! is_dir($publicPath.'/..')) {
@@ -42,7 +42,7 @@ class LinkCommand extends Command
             return $this->error("The \"{$basePath}\" directory already exists.");
         }
 
-        $distPath = realpath(__DIR__ . '/../../resources/dist');
+        $distPath = realpath(__DIR__ . '/../../../resources/dist');
 
         $this->laravel->make('files')->link(
             $distPath, $publicPath

+ 1 - 1
src/Console/ImportCommand.php

@@ -72,7 +72,7 @@ class ImportCommand extends VendorPublishCommand
             $this->publishItem(
                 $assets,
                 public_path(
-                    Admin::assets()->getRealPath('@extension').'/'.$extension::NAME
+                    Admin::asset()->getRealPath('@extension').'/'.$extension::NAME
                 )
             );
         }

+ 2 - 2
src/Console/UninstallCommand.php

@@ -45,8 +45,8 @@ class UninstallCommand extends Command
     protected function removeFilesAndDirectories()
     {
         $this->laravel['files']->deleteDirectory(config('admin.directory'));
-        $this->laravel['files']->deleteDirectory(public_path(Admin::assets()->getRealPath('@extension')));
-        $this->laravel['files']->deleteDirectory(public_path(Admin::assets()->getRealPath('@admin')));
+        $this->laravel['files']->deleteDirectory(public_path(Admin::asset()->getRealPath('@extension')));
+        $this->laravel['files']->deleteDirectory(public_path(Admin::asset()->getRealPath('@admin')));
         $this->laravel['files']->delete(config_path('admin.php'));
     }
 }

+ 0 - 0
src/Layout/Assets.php → src/Layout/Asset.php


+ 12 - 12
src/Traits/HasAssets.php

@@ -26,11 +26,11 @@ trait HasAssets
     }
 
     /**
-     * @return \Dcat\Admin\Layout\Assets
+     * @return \Dcat\Admin\Layout\Asset
      */
-    public static function assets()
+    public static function asset()
     {
-        return app('admin.assets');
+        return app('admin.asset');
     }
 
     /**
@@ -41,7 +41,7 @@ trait HasAssets
      */
     public static function collectAssets(string $name, string $type = '')
     {
-        static::assets()->collect($name, $type);
+        static::asset()->collect($name, $type);
     }
 
     /**
@@ -53,7 +53,7 @@ trait HasAssets
      */
     public static function css($css)
     {
-        static::assets()->css($css);
+        static::asset()->css($css);
     }
 
     /**
@@ -65,7 +65,7 @@ trait HasAssets
      */
     public static function baseCss(array $css)
     {
-        static::assets()->baseCss($css);
+        static::asset()->baseCss($css);
     }
 
     /**
@@ -77,7 +77,7 @@ trait HasAssets
      */
     public static function js($js)
     {
-        static::assets()->js($js);
+        static::asset()->js($js);
     }
 
     /**
@@ -89,7 +89,7 @@ trait HasAssets
      */
     public static function headerJs($js)
     {
-        static::assets()->headerJs($js);
+        static::asset()->headerJs($js);
     }
 
     /**
@@ -101,7 +101,7 @@ trait HasAssets
      */
     public static function baseJs(array $js)
     {
-        static::assets()->baseJs($js);
+        static::asset()->baseJs($js);
     }
 
     /**
@@ -111,7 +111,7 @@ trait HasAssets
      */
     public static function script($script)
     {
-        static::assets()->script($script);
+        static::asset()->script($script);
     }
 
     /**
@@ -121,7 +121,7 @@ trait HasAssets
      */
     public static function style($style)
     {
-        static::assets()->style($style);
+        static::asset()->style($style);
     }
 
     /**
@@ -131,6 +131,6 @@ trait HasAssets
      */
     public static function fonts($font)
     {
-        static::assets()->fonts = $font;
+        static::asset()->fonts = $font;
     }
 }

+ 1 - 1
src/Widgets/DialogForm.php

@@ -306,7 +306,7 @@ JS
         Admin::baseJs([]);
         Admin::fonts(false);
 
-        Admin::assets()->full();
+        Admin::asset()->full();
 
         $form->wrap(function ($v) {
             return $v;